Corruption cases require specialized legal expertise as they involve strict laws, government regulations, and investigation by authorities such as the Anti-Corruption Bureau (ACB). A Nashik anti corruption lawyer provides professional legal assistance in cases of bribery, misuse of authority, financial irregularities, and other corruption-related offenses. They ensure that clientsβ rights are protected while offering strong defense strategies before the court.

In Nashik, anti corruption lawyers handle cases involving public servants, government employees, corporate professionals, and individuals accused under anti-corruption laws. They assist in filing complaints, defending against false charges, and representing clients during investigation and trial stages. With in-depth knowledge of anti-corruption statutes, these lawyers provide effective legal support to achieve favorable outcomes.
Hiring an experienced anti corruption lawyer in Nashik is essential to navigate the complexities of such cases. Their expertise in handling investigation procedures, presenting arguments, and ensuring compliance with the Prevention of Corruption Act makes them reliable legal partners. Whether you are a complainant or facing charges, the right lawyer can help protect your rights and reputation.

An anti corruption lawyer handles cases related to bribery, abuse of power, and misuse of public office. They represent clients during investigations, hearings, and trials, ensuring their legal rights are protected.
Corruption cases are primarily governed by the Prevention of Corruption Act, 1988, along with other relevant Indian Penal Code (IPC) provisions. The Anti-Corruption Bureau (ACB) also investigates such cases.
Yes, an experienced lawyer can defend against false accusations by presenting evidence, challenging the prosecutionβs claims, and ensuring that due process is followed throughout the proceedings.
Cases of bribery, illegal gratification, financial irregularities, misuse of authority, and disproportionate assets are generally covered under anti-corruption laws. Both public officials and private individuals may be involved.
These cases involve complex legal processes and strict penalties. A skilled lawyer provides legal advice, prepares strong defenses, and represents clients effectively to safeguard their rights and reputation.
